'Absolute scenes; Oh lordy' – Some Leeds fans think the Man City clash has just got even tastier

Leeds United welcome Man City to Elland Road on Saturday in a game that won’t need any help to be box office.

However, it might just get it after the Premier League announced the list of officials for this weekend’s games. The man heading to Elland Road? Mike Dean.

Dean makes the headlines an awful lot for a referee and was in amongst it again in the game between West Brom and Everton in gameweek two.

He sent off West Brom manager Slaven Bilic after the Croatian went looking for answers to some first-half decisions.

Following this, Dean came in for criticism from many pundits, although none were more outspoken than former Villa striker Gabby Agbonlahor.

He said on talkSPORT, “Mike Dean is the most arrogant fool you will ever see… in not just refereeing but in life itself. I’ve never met anyone like him.”
